In the context of CAI, what does better mean (colder air and or more air)? How will you know if it works better? Just curious.
 
Because they said so, the more you monkey the more you can.
 
I am talking intake temps comparing to my last cai

I dont think you'll notice much of a difference.

Intake temps are mostly affected by the intercooler and how efficiently it's working. (clear/plugged with snow/bigger etc.)

I think a great comparison would be clutch/belt temps, as that ram air blocks all incoming air meant to cool clutches. JMO...
 
I dont think you'll notice much of a difference.

Intake temps are mostly affected by the intercooler and how efficiently it's working. (clear/plugged with snow/bigger etc.)

I think a great comparison would be clutch/belt temps, as that ram air blocks all incoming air meant to cool clutches. JMO...
